init_pbdma_intr_descs HAL ops is used to update the internal values of
the struct intr within struct fifo_gk20a. Three kinds of
intr_descriptors are filled i.e. device_fatal_0, channel_fatal_0 and
restartable_0. Breaking them into separate HALs has the advantage of
reusing the h/w headers corresponding to the device_fatal_0 as they are
same across all the architectures while those of channel_fatal_0 varies.
Another advantage is to now decouple pbdma from filling in values
within the fifo_gk20a struct. A new method gk20a_fifo_init_pbdma_descs
is constructed that initializes the above intr struct by calling the
separate HAL ops for these.

Register write from gr_gk20a_init_fs_state function are moved to hal.
New hal added for setting the pd_tpc_per_gpc, pd_skip_table_gpc and
cwd_gpcs_tpcs_num.
pd_tpc_per_gpc helps to describe the number of tpcs in each logical
gpc.
pd_skip_table helps to skip certain TPCs during distribution.
cwd_gpcs_tpcs_num helps to set number of tpcs and gpcs in CWD.
remove write for depreciated NV_PBE_PRI_ZROP_SETTING_NUM_ACTIVE_FBPS
and NV_PBE_PRI_CROP_SETTINS_NUM_ACTIVE_FBPS fields from
BES_ZROP_SETTINGS and BES_CROP_SETTINGS registers. Both these fields
changed to NUM_ACTIVE_LTCS from gm20b onwards and those are being
set in existing hal functions.

gr_gk20a_init_golden_ctx_image() right now resets sys/gpc/be units by
directly accessing gr_fecs_ctxsw_reset_ctl_r() register
Move this register write/read sequence to common.hal.gr.init unit
through HAL operation g->ops.gr.init.override_context_reset()
Use new HAL in gr_gk20a_init_golden_ctx_image()
Also fix the delay() operations. delay() should be added before we read
back gr_fecs_ctxsw_reset_ctl_r() register and not after
